Understanding Sash Windows
Sash windows consist of one or more movable panels, called 'sashes,' that open and close vertically. They are typically discovered in the United Kingdom and other locations affected by British architecture. Their unique style includes a classic aesthetic that has actually stood the test of time, making them popular among homeowner and conservationists alike.
Common Issues Faced by Sash Windows
Sash windows, while gorgeous, are not resistant to damage. Property owners often experience issues such as:
Drafts: Old or harmed window frames typically allow air leakage, leading to expensive heating bills.Trouble in Operation: Over time, the mechanisms responsible for moving the sashes might use down, causing jams or tightness.Wear and tear: Exposure to the aspects might cause the wood to rot, paint to peel, or glass to crack.Increased Noise Pollution: Poor insulation can make homes noisy, impacting locals' convenience.Why Opt for Sash Window Refurbishment?
Reconditioning sash windows not only restores their functionality however likewise enhances their aesthetic appeal. Here are some factors house owners may consider a refurbishment service:

Preservation of Historical Value: Many homes with sash windows are noted or found in sanctuary. Refurbishing instead of replacing these windows assists keep the building's historic stability.

Energy Efficiency: Newly refurbished sash windows can provide better insulation, helping to minimize energy expenses by decreasing heat loss.

Cost-Effectiveness: Refurbishment is often cheaper than full replacement and can yield similar benefits.

Personalization Options: Homeowners can typically pick surfaces, colors, and products that align with their vision while respecting the initial style.

Environmental Benefits: Refurbishing windows implies less waste compared to the disposal of old windows, contributing to total sustainability.
The Sash Window Refurbishment Process
Reconditioning sash windows typically includes several essential steps to make sure that completion outcome is both stunning and functional. The following table lays out each stage of the refurbishment process.
PhaseDetails1. EvaluationSpecialists evaluate the condition of the windows, identifying specific concerns.2. RemovalSashes might be carefully eliminated from their frames for closer assessment.3. RepairsHarmed wood is changed, and mechanisms are repaired or changed as required.4. Stripping and SandingOld paint layers are stripped away, and wood surface areas are sanded to ensure a smooth finish.5. Priming and PaintingNew guide and paint are applied, appreciating the original design and color where possible.6. ReinstallationRefurbished sashes are reinstalled, and any necessary adjustments are produced ease of usage.7. Final InspectionFinished windows are completely checked to guarantee optimal function and visual integrity.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
